Quick answer

ZIP 83324 sits in Lincoln County, Idaho and is home to 771 people. Median household income is $66,250, the median home is worth $241,700 and median gross rent is $781. 75% of households own their home, and purchases are taxed at 6% (Idaho state rate).

A rent burden above 30% is the federal threshold for cost-burdened households, and a price-to-income multiple above 4× is generally considered a stretched housing market. The mortgage figure is principal and interest only — taxes, insurance and HOA dues are extra.

Is a ZCTA the same as a postal ZIP code?
Not exactly. The Census builds ZIP Code Tabulation Areas from the ZIP codes of addresses inside each census block, so a ZCTA can differ slightly from the USPS delivery route of the same number, and PO-box-only ZIPs have no ZCTA at all.
